I have some Bassani RR 2's and just got a clean break on the bracket. I was shocked since it is pretty heavy duty, and snapped between 2 of the mounting holes. My neighbors kid welded it back up literally better than new. The bracket has 2 gussets that were welded down 1 side. He welded them all the way around and showed me the weak point. Not bashing Bassani by any means, bit their warrantee looked like it would be more trouble than it was worth. Only cost me a 12 pack and no haggling or shipping headaches.
